The Bangladesh National Anthem, Flag and Emblem Order, 1972 (President's Order)

Act No. 130 of 1972

Enacted: 1972-01-01

Chapter 1
General

1.1.

1. (1) This Order may be called the Bangladesh National Anthem, Flag and Emblem Order, 1972. (2) It extends to the whole of Bangladesh. (3) It shall come into force at once.

2. The National Anthem shall be the first ten lines of Kabi Guru Rabindranath Tagore's “Amar Sonar Bangla”as set out in the First Schedule.

3. The National Flag shall consist of a circle, coloured red throughout its area, resting on a green background. The size and other features of the National Flag shall be in accordance with the specifications set out in the Second Schedule.

4. The National Emblem shall be the national flower Shapla (nymphaea nouchali) resting on water, having on each side an ear of paddy and being surmounted by three connected leaves of jute with two stars on each side of the leaves, as specified in the Third Schedule.

4A 1 [4A. Whoever Contravenes any provision of this Order or of any rules made thereunder shall be punishable with imprisonment for a term which may extend to one year or with fine which may extend to Taka five thousand, or with both.]

1 [5. The Government may, by notification in the Official Gazette, make rules for carrying out the purposes of this Order.]

6. Subject to the provisions of this Order, the People's Republic of Bangladesh Flag Rules, 1972, and the National Emblem Rules, 1972, shall, so far as applicable and until amended and repealed, continue to have effect.
